Personal data Jean Charles van Gavere Herimez Comte de Fresin, baron d'Inchy 


Household of Jean Charles van Gavere Herimez Comte de Fresin, baron d'Inchy

He is married to Françoise de Renty.

They got married on March 15, 1586, he was 21 years old.


Child(ren):

  1. Pierre Ernst van Gavere Herimez  ± 1586-± 1636

Jean Charles was een zoon uit het eerste huwelijk van ; Charles de Gavre  de Beaurieu , Saint Empire, d'Inchy en d'Ollignies, de Frezin, en d'Aiseau gouveneur d'Ath  superintendant des vivres de l'armée des Pays-Bas (1535-1610) met Margaretha v/d Marck.  Zijn tweede huwelijk was met Honorine d'Esclatiere, dame d'Aiseau.
